US explains why it abstained on ICC vote to postpone Kenyatta, Ruto’s case

By PHILIP MWAKIO

NAIROBI, KENYA: The US government has given an explanation as to why it abstained on its vote at the recent United Nations Security Council 15 member that led to a failed bid to defer trials President Uhuru Kenyatta and Deputy William Ruto’s date at the International Criminal Court (ICC).
